Chemistry Check: Look Beyond Attraction

If the spark is real, pause and use it to learn whether you and a potential partner fit in ways that matter long term. Chemistry is powerful, but compatibility comes from shared values, compatible lifestyles, clear goals, and healthy communication. Ask gentle, specific questions early and observe how answers feel in conversation.

Talk About What Matters

Bring up core topics in casual ways—values, future plans, daily routines, and how each of you handles stress. Try questions like:

  • Values: "What principles matter most to you in a relationship?" or "How do you show care when someone is important to you?"
  • Relationship goals: "What does a successful relationship look like to you in a year or five years?"
  • Lifestyle fit: "What does a typical weekend look like for you? How do you like to spend downtime?"
  • Communication style: "Do you prefer to talk things out right away or take time to process?"
  • Boundaries: "What are your non-negotiables or deal-breakers in a partnership?"

Watch For Practical Signals

Listen as much as you ask. Notice whether their answers align with how they behave—consistency matters. Pay attention to how they treat other people, how they manage commitments, and whether their daily life could coexist with yours (work hours, social life, family obligations, financial habits).

Test The Fit With Small Steps

Try low-stakes shared activities to see real-life compatibility: a quick hike, cooking together, or running an errand. These moments reveal habits, patience, and how you negotiate small conflicts—often more telling than big declarations.

Respect Differences And Set Boundaries

Compatibility doesn’t require identical preferences. Prioritize values and deal-breakers, then negotiate differences respectfully. Be honest about your boundaries and listen when they set theirs. If something feels off, it’s okay to slow down or step away.

Keep Conversations Constructive

Use "I" statements to share needs, ask open-ended questions, and avoid grilling in early conversations. If deeper issues surface, suggest more thoughtful discussions later. A healthy chemistry check is curious, kind, and realistic—not an interrogation.

Dating Confidence Reset: Practical Steps To Feel Grounded

Start by clarifying what you genuinely want. Take five minutes to write down your top two priorities for dating right now — companionship, casual conversation, long-term potential, or simply practice. When your goals are clear, it’s easier to say yes to the right conversations and no to the ones that drain you.

Set realistic expectations and pace yourself. Not every chat needs to become a date or a long-term connection. Give new conversations room to breathe: aim for a few messages over several days before moving to a phone call or meeting. This slows the rush to judge someone too quickly and protects your energy.

Treat matches as signals, not scores. Moving away from a numbers-game mindset helps reduce discouragement. A low reply rate or a few bad dates don’t mean you’re invisible—see each interaction as information about who fits your priorities and who doesn’t.

Notice small progress and set micro-goals. Celebrate clear wins like starting a respectful conversation, asking for a call, or politely ending a chat that isn’t working. Micro-goals keep momentum without creating pressure for instant chemistry.

Protect your emotional steady state. Schedule regular breaks, limit swiping or messaging time, and use simple check-ins: Are you curious, bored, hopeful, or drained? When you feel drained, step back and do something restorative before returning.

Choose matches more thoughtfully. Scan profiles for three specific red flags or green flags that matter to you—values, communication style, or shared interests—before investing time. This filters out distractions and raises the chance of more meaningful conversations.
